## Configuration

Spoolnik reads its settings from `.env` in the repo root. Most defaults are fine for local dev — queue depth, retry backoff, and the PDF renderer path all have sane values baked in. The only thing you truly must set is the broker credential Spoolnik uses to claim print jobs. Add this line to your `.env`:

vault entry, kagep-yajeg: COURIER_KEY5=da097

# Break-Glass: Catalog Cache Invalidation

Scope: the Pinrow product catalog at Veldstone Retail. If stale prices persist after a purge and the Hollowmere invalidation queue is wedged, use break-glass to flush the edge tier directly. Contractors: get verbal sign-off from the catalog lead first. Steps: open the Hollowmere admin shell, select emergency-flush, confirm the tenant, and run it once — repeated flushes thrash the origin. Access is logged and expires after 20 minutes. Unseal the admin shell with the passphrase below.

recovery phrase for kahop-tajog: istix-casvan

Q2 Planning — Cash-Flow Forecast, Brindlecote Retail Group

Branch managers: forecast assumes flat footfall and a 3% uplift in average basket across all Brindlecote locations. Receivables tighten to 30 days; supplier terms extend to 45. Capex deferred except the Marwick refit. Weekly cash submissions due each Friday by noon, no exceptions. Shortfalls above 5% of plan trigger a call with Treasury. Hold local spend until the midpoint review. The plan supporting these figures is summarised below.

confidential, bafog-tafog: The renewal with Zorathek Group closes at $5 million a year, 10 percent below the last contract. Project Zorwyn slips by a full year because of the staffing delay.